First Claim
1. A gas analysis system comprising in combination:
- a piston-pump sampler comprising a hypodermic syringe including a synthetic, plastic housing defining a sample chamber, a piston housed with the chamber, a plunger secured to the piston and extending out of one end of the chamber, an outlet at the other end of the chamber and a threaded annular member secured to said body surrounding said outlet;
a gas analysis unit having an inlet adapted to sealingly engage the threaded annular member of the sampler outlet during injection of sample into the unit;
a needle assembly configured to sealingly and releasably engage said threaded annular member; and
a sealing member adapted to releasably and sealingly engage said threaded annular member.

Abstract
A system for atmospheric monitoring is disclosed. Atmospheric dispersion of a plume is monitored by continuously releasing a tracer gas such as sulfur hexafluoride into the plume, collecting air samples downwind and analyzing the samples. The system includes plastic piston pump samplers having a locking outlet receiving removable nozzles or a lock-seal closure. The samples are analyzed by means of a tracer specific gas-chromatograph-electron capture (GC-EC) detector having a lock-seal inlet adapted to engage the sampler outlet. In a preferred system, the atmospheric samples are collected by automatic, sequentially operated samplers and analyzed by means of a plurality of GC-EC detectors operating in parallel such that the trailing oxygen band is eluted through the first detector as the last detector is being loaded. Thus, the system is in continuous operation and minimizes operator time, and 80 samples can be analyzed in one hour. A multiple input, digital integrator having means for integrating peaks formed during baseline drift provides continuous, reliable read-out data from the signals from the multiple GC-EC detectors.
